At Blake Street, you'll find a convenient ticket office with various opening times throughout the week. Monday sees the earliest start at 6 AM, winding down by 4 PM, while the rest of the week offers a mix of shorter hours. For added convenience, ticket machines are available, including options to collect tickets you purchased online. While Blake Street lacks some modern amenities like public Wi-Fi or refreshment facilities, rest assured that essential features like CCTV and staff assistance during opening hours bolster the station's safety and security. It should be noted that step-free access is available, although limited to certain parts of the station.
Traveling beyond the station is straightforward with several transport links available. Rail replacement services are organized from the car park entrance on Shelley Drive when needed, while local cab services such as Sutton Radio and Parkers offer taxi options. The public bus network is an accessory to your journey as well, with printable information available online to help plan your onward trip. Wandsworth Common station prides itself on being user-friendly with a plethora of facilities. The ticket office operates from early mornings to nearly midnight, offering flexibility for your travel plans. If buying tickets in advance suits you better, pick them up at the available ticket machines. Accessibility is a thoughtful addition here, with induction loops and Disabled Persons Railcard-enabled ticket machines ensuring ease for everyone.
While the station doesn’t have waiting rooms, you can find seating areas to relax before catching your train. Safety is prioritized through the presence of CCTV, and while luggage storage is unavailable, the staff offers assistance for those who need help navigating the station. The charming simplicity of Wandsworth is slightly amplified by a free 24-hour parking service managed by APCOA Parking UK, with space for 25 vehicles, including one accessible spot.

For the cycle enthusiasts, the station offers 66 bicycle storage spaces, sheltered and monitored by CCTV. While there's no cycle hire available on-site, it's easy to meander through the picturesque streets of Wandsworth by renting a bike nearby.
